How to Make Healthy Zucchini Lasagna Rolls

Preparation Steps

Slicing the Zucchini

Carefully slice your zucchinis lengthwise with the mandolin to create long, even strips that will serve as the lasagna sheets.

Assembling the Rolls

Lay out the slices, spread with ricotta mixture, top with mozzarella, then carefully roll and place in the baking dish seam side down.

Baking Instructions

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Once the rolls are assembled, cover them with marinara sauce and a sprinkle of Parmesan cheese. Bake for about 30 minutes until bubbly and golden. Let them sit for a few minutes before serving.

Serving and Storage Tips for Zucchini Lasagna Rolls

Serving Tips

Serve hot along with a side salad or steamed vegetables to make a complete meal. Pair it with a light red wine to complement the flavors.

Storage Tips

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. For longer preservation, freeze them, ensuring they are tightly wrapped to prevent freezer burn.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Making Zucchini Lasagna Rolls

Avoiding Soggy Rolls

To avoid soggy rolls, ensure that the zucchini slices are patted dry with paper towels before using them. You can also pre-cook them slightly before assembly.

Ensuring Even Cooking

Uniformity is key; ensure each roll is similar in size and thickness to allow even cooking throughout the dish.

FAQs:


Can I make these rolls ahead of time?

Absolutely! These rolls can be prepared a day in advance. Follow the preparation steps and assemble them in the baking dish. Cover and refrigerate until you’re ready to bake them. You’ll need to add an extra 10 minutes to the baking time if cooking directly from the fridge.


What’s the best way to prevent my rolls from becoming too watery?

The key is to draw out excess moisture from the zucchini slices. You can salt them lightly and let them sit for about 15 minutes, then pat them dry with paper towels before using. This will help ensure they retain their lovely shape and texture during cooking.


Can I Freeze Zucchini Lasagna Rolls?

Yes, you can. Once baked, allow them to cool completely before transferring to a freezer-safe container. They can be stored in the freezer for up to 3 months. Thaw them in the refrigerator overnight before reheating at 350°F (175°C) until heated through.


What Other Fillings Can I Use?

You can experiment with various fillings such as cooked ground beef for a meatier dish, or incorporate other vegetables like spinach or mushrooms to add more flavors and textures. The key is to ensure any additional fillings are cooked down to prevent excess moisture.


How do I ensure they stay tightly rolled?

To keep them tightly rolled, not only is it important to pack the filling evenly, but rolling them carefully and placing them seam side down in the dish helps maintain their shape during baking.

Healthy Zucchini Lasagna Rolls Recipe


  • Author: Jennifer
  • Total Time: 45 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ings

Description

Zucchini Lasagna Rolls offer a healthy twist on classic Italian lasagna by replacing pasta with fresh, thinly sliced zucchini. Enjoy layers of melted mozzarella, ricotta, and hearty marinara combined with herbs for a low-carb, satisfying meal.


Ingredients

  • Fresh medium zucchini
  • Mozzarella cheese
  • Ricotta cheese
  • Parmesan cheese
  • Marinara sauce
  • Herbs (basil, oregano)
  • Salt
  • Pepper

Instructions

  • Preheat the oven to 375°F.
  • Using a mandolin slicer, cut the zucchini lengthwise into thin slices.
  • Spread a mixture of ricotta, mozzarella, and chopped herbs on each zucchini slice.
  • Roll each slice tightly and arrange in a baking dish.
  • Top the rolls with marinara sauce and a sprinkle of Parmesan cheese.
  • Bake for 30 minutes until the cheese is bubbly and the edges are crisp.

Notes

Ensure zucchinis are firm for easy slicing and adjust cheese types to your preference. For extra flavor, add basil or oregano.
